在创建如下文件夹:/opt/rocketmq/logs,/opt/rocketmq/store,最后创建 docker-compose.yml 文件,配置如下: 代码语言:javascript 复制 version:'3'services:namesrv:image:rocketmqinc/rocketmqcontainer_name:rmqnamesrvports:-9876:9876volumes:-/opt/rocketmq/logs:/home/rocketmq/logs-/opt/rocketmq/store:/home...
这里将会使用 springboot 快速上手使用 mq,将会使用rocketmq-spring-boot-starter模块。 pom 配置如下 代码语言:javascript 复制 <!--在pom.xml中添加依赖--><dependency><groupid>org.apache.rocketmq</groupid><artifactid>rocketmq-spring-boot-starter</artifactid><version>2.0.3</version></dependency> grad...
Apache RocketMQ是一款开源的分布式消息中间件,具有高吞吐量、高可用性、高伸缩性和灵活的可靠消息传输机制等特点。RocketMQ支持多种消息模式,包括异步传输、同步传输和单向传输,并支持多种订阅模式,包括广播模式和集群模式。RocketMQ还提供了丰富的API和管理工具,可以轻松地进行消息的发送、订阅和管理。 RocketMQ的主要特...
JAVA_OPTS是传递给Java的参数。 步骤4:启动RocketMQ的Broker 接下来,我们需要启动Broker。使用以下命令: dockerrun-d--namermqbroker\-e"JAVA_OPTS=-Drocketmq.namesrv.addr=rmqnamesrv:9876"\-e"BROKER_ID=0"\-p10911:10911\rocketmqinc/rocketmq:4.9.3bash-c"cd /home/rocketmq && sh bin/mqbroker -n...
mkdir -p /Users/xxx/rocketmq/broker/logs /Users/xxx/rocketmq/broker/store /Users/xxx/rocketmq/broker/conf 2.2 修改broker 配置文件(上一步创建的【/Users/xxx/rocketmq/broker/conf】 目录下创建 broker.conf) , 这里的ip 注意是宿主机ip
1 Docker安装RocketMQ 1.1 安装流程 #拉取镜像 docker pull foxiswho/rocketmq:server-4.3.2 docker pull foxiswho/rocketmq:broker-4.3.2 #创建nameserver容器 docker create -p 9876:9876 --name rmqserver \ -e "JAVA_OPT_EXT=-server -Xms128m -Xmx128m -Xmn128m" \ ...
docker run -d --name rmqnamesrv -p 9876:9876 --network rocketmq apache/rocketmq:5.1.4 sh mqnamesrv # 验证 NameServer 是否启动成功 docker logs -f rmqnamesrv 6.修改配置 正常会在当前执行目录下新建一个RocketMQ5.1.4目录,其下有一个名broker.conf配置文件: ...
在本地通过Docker安装RocketMQ 拉取镜像 & 部署 这里选用foxiswho/rocketmq:server-4.5.1版本,在官方镜像没出来前,foxiswho是一个比较靠谱的第三方镜像。 执行下面的命令直接启动Name Server。 docker run -d -p 9876:9876 --name rmqnamesrv foxiswho/rocketmq:server-4.5.1...
接下来,我们将按照以下步骤进行 RocketMQ-4.9.3 的 Docker 安装:步骤1:拉取 RocketMQ-4.9.3 的 Docker 镜像使用以下命令从 Docker Hub 上拉取 RocketMQ-4.9.3 的 Docker 镜像: docker pull apache/rocketmq:4.9.3 步骤2:创建一个新的网络连接Docker 允许您为容器创建一个独立的网络,以便容器之间可以相互...
Docker Compose(可选):虽然本文主要使用Docker命令行工具进行安装,但了解Docker Compose也有助于管理多容器应用。 网络连接:确保您的系统能够访问Docker镜像仓库,以便下载RocketMQ镜像。 检查Docker安装 执行以下命令,确认Docker已正确安装并运行: docker --version ...